I believe you are talking about Cape-goosberry or Goldenberry (Physalis peruviana, and similar species), in the Nightshade Family (Solanceae), and not the European Gooseberry (Ribes uva-crispa, and similar species), in the Currant Family (Grossulariaceae).

The fruit of the Cape-gooseberry are not large, usually betweeen 1 to 2 cm wide. It can take several months for green fruit to fully ripen. In the end, how long did the fruit stay green on your plants before ripening?
